Ground beef + leafy greens = lettuce wraps!
The meat is easy. Just brown and add your favorite teriyaki sauce. Ours is Soy Vay.
The rest is pretty easy, too. Wrap your meat in your favorite edible leaf. We had a plethora of bok choy last summer.
You can also use the smaller leaves and seasonal veggies to make a stir fry side.
